How Can Different Pillow Arrangements Support Various Sleeping Positions?
Stomach sleepers should opt for a very soft or thin pillow to prevent the neck from twisting, which can lead to discomfort. For added support, placing a pillow under the pelvis can aid in keeping the spine aligned and alleviate pressure on the lower back.
Combination sleepers, who change positions frequently, may find adjustable or multi-purpose pillows beneficial. These pillows can be modified in thickness and firmness based on individual needs, allowing seamless transitions between sleeping positions without sacrificing comfort.
Pregnant sleepers often require extra support for their changing bodies; a body pillow or multiple smaller pillows can support the belly and back effectively. This arrangement helps to alleviate pressure on the spine and hips, promoting better sleep quality during pregnancy.
What Are the Most Common Pillow Sizes for Effective Arrangements?
The most common pillow sizes for effective arrangements are:
- Standard Pillow (20″ x 26″): The standard pillow is the most commonly used size and is versatile for various bed sizes. It fits well on twin and full beds, providing adequate support for the head and neck while allowing for multiple arrangements with decorative pillows.
- Queen Pillow (20″ x 30″): Slightly larger than the standard, queen pillows are great for queen-sized beds and offer more surface area for comfort. They can create a visually appealing layered look when combined with smaller decorative pillows in an arrangement.
- King Pillow (20″ x 36″): King pillows are designed for king-sized beds and provide ample support across the width of the bed. Their elongated shape makes them ideal for creating a dramatic backdrop for smaller pillows and adds a plush, luxurious feel to the bedding ensemble.
- Euro Pillow (26″ x 26″): Euro pillows are square and often used as decorative elements in the back of a pillow arrangement. They serve both functional and aesthetic purposes, providing support when sitting up in bed and creating a visually appealing layered effect with other pillow sizes.
- Decorative Pillow (various sizes): Decorative pillows come in various sizes, often smaller than standard pillows, and are used to add color, texture, and personality to the bedding. They can be arranged in front of larger pillows to create depth and interest, making them essential for achieving the best pillow arrangement.
How Does Pillow Arrangement Influence Overall Sleep Quality?
The arrangement of pillows can significantly impact sleep quality by providing proper support and alignment for the body.
- Head and Neck Support: Properly arranged pillows can support the head and neck, maintaining spinal alignment. A pillow that is too high or too flat can lead to discomfort and strain, affecting overall sleep quality.
- Back Sleeping Position: For back sleepers, placing a pillow under the knees can help relieve pressure on the lower back. This arrangement encourages a neutral spine position, which can reduce discomfort and improve sleep quality.
- Side Sleeping Position: Side sleepers benefit from placing a firm pillow between the knees to help align the hips and reduce strain on the lower back. Additionally, a supportive pillow for the head is essential to keep the neck aligned with the spine.
- Stomach Sleeping Position: Stomach sleepers may require a very thin pillow or none at all to prevent neck strain. Arranging pillows in a way that minimizes elevation can help maintain a neutral spine position and prevent discomfort.
- Elevation for Breathing: Elevating the upper body with an extra pillow can benefit individuals with breathing issues like snoring or sleep apnea. This arrangement can open up the airways, making it easier to breathe during sleep.
- Comfort and Personal Preference: The best pillow arrangement is also influenced by personal comfort preferences, including pillow firmness and material. Experimenting with different configurations can help individuals find the most comfortable setup for their unique sleeping style.
What Are Some Stylish and Practical Pillow Arrangement Ideas for Different Bedroom Aesthetics?
Here are some stylish and practical pillow arrangement ideas for various bedroom aesthetics:
- Layered Pillows: This arrangement involves stacking different sizes of pillows, often starting with larger ones at the back and gradually decreasing in size towards the front. This creates a visually appealing depth and can be adapted to any aesthetic, from modern to traditional.
- Symmetrical Arrangement: Positioning pillows in a balanced manner on either side of the bed adds a sense of order and calmness to the space. Typically, this includes two matching larger pillows and smaller decorative pillows in between, perfect for minimalist or classic bedroom styles.
- Asymmetrical Arrangement: For a more relaxed and contemporary look, consider an asymmetrical arrangement where pillows are placed in a more casual, uneven manner. This can involve grouping pillows of various sizes and patterns on one side, giving the bed a more inviting and informal feel.
- Accent Pillows: Incorporating a few accent pillows with unique designs or textures can elevate the overall look of your bedding. Choose colors that complement your bedspread or wall colors to tie the room together, making it suitable for bohemian or eclectic aesthetics.
- Throw Pillows: Adding smaller throw pillows in front of your main pillows introduces a layer of comfort and style. These can be varied in texture and color, allowing for seasonal updates or changes, making them ideal for trendy or seasonal bedroom aesthetics.
- European Shams: Using European shams, which are larger square pillows, can add an element of sophistication to a bed arrangement. Placing one or two of these in the back row can provide a plush backdrop and is especially suited for luxurious or upscale bedroom designs.
- Color Block Arrangement: For a bold statement, consider arranging pillows in a color block pattern where you group pillows of similar hues together. This modern approach works well in contemporary or vibrant bedrooms, creating a striking visual impact.
- Seasonal Rotation: Change your pillow arrangements according to the season by swapping out colors and patterns. This keeps the bedroom feeling fresh and relevant, allowing for a dynamic aesthetic that can reflect seasonal themes, such as bright colors in summer or warm tones in winter.
How Can I Customize My Pillow Arrangement Based on Personal Preferences and Needs?
Customizing your pillow arrangement can greatly enhance comfort and support while also reflecting your personal style.
- Supportive Backrest: A supportive backrest pillow is ideal for those who enjoy reading or watching TV in bed. This type of pillow typically has a firmer structure, allowing your back to maintain a comfortable and aligned position while providing adequate support for your lower back.
- Decorative Throw Pillows: Incorporating decorative throw pillows not only adds personality to your bedding but also allows for flexibility in your pillow arrangement. These pillows can come in various shapes, sizes, and patterns, enabling you to create a visually appealing setup that complements your bedroom decor.
- Body Pillows: Body pillows are great for side sleepers or those who like to cuddle with a pillow for added comfort. They provide support along the entire length of the body, helping to maintain spinal alignment and reducing pressure points, which can lead to better sleep quality.
- Euro Pillows: Euro pillows are square pillows that can serve both functional and aesthetic purposes. Positioned against the headboard or as a layer behind your sleeping pillows, they enhance the overall look of your bed while providing additional support when sitting up.
- Neck Pillows: If you often experience neck pain, incorporating a neck pillow into your arrangement can help. These specially designed pillows support the cervical spine and promote proper alignment, making them a great addition for those who sleep on their back or side.
- Adjustable Pillows: Adjustable pillows allow you to customize the loft and firmness to suit your sleeping style. Featuring removable inserts or adjustable fill, these pillows can cater to different preferences, ensuring you find the best support for a restful night’s sleep.
What Tips Can Enhance Comfort and Aesthetics in My Pillow Arrangement?
To enhance comfort and aesthetics in your pillow arrangement, consider the following tips:
- Layering: Layering pillows of different sizes and shapes creates visual interest and depth. Start with larger pillows at the back, then add medium-sized ones, and finish with smaller decorative cushions at the front for a balanced look.
- Color Coordination: Choose a color palette that complements your room’s decor to ensure the pillows tie into the overall aesthetic. Mixing solid colors with patterns can add vibrancy, but be sure to maintain harmony by selecting colors that work well together.
- Mixing Textures: Incorporating various textures, such as soft velvet, crisp cotton, or chunky knits, can enhance the tactile experience of your pillow arrangement. This variety not only appeals visually but also invites touch, making your space feel more inviting.
- Symmetry vs. Asymmetry: Decide whether you want a symmetrical look, which conveys order and formality, or an asymmetrical arrangement for a more casual, relaxed vibe. Each approach can significantly alter the ambiance of a room, so choose based on your personal style and the setting.
- Functional Placement: Consider the function of the pillows when arranging them. For example, larger pillows can provide back support when sitting, while smaller decorative pillows can serve as accents without interfering with comfort, ensuring both style and practicality.
- Seasonal Changes: Refresh your pillow arrangement seasonally by swapping out colors and textures to reflect the changing seasons. Light, airy fabrics and bright colors work well in spring and summer, while warmer tones and heavier fabrics can create a cozy atmosphere in fall and winter.
